Role of women in potato production and value addition at household processing level
Authors
Rashmee Yadav, Amisha Kumari, Smita Tripathi, Neelma Kunwar
Abstract
Women play a pivotal role in ensuring potato adoption and utilization within the household, as well as in managing diet diversification, food preparation, and household consumption including infant and child feeding. Different preferences of women and men as farmers and consumers are important to ensure sustained adoption of new varieties. In India, potato is cultivated in almost all states under diverse agro-climatic conditions. About 85 per cent of potatoes are cultivated in Indo-Gangetic plains of North India. The states of Uttar Pradesh, West Bengal, Punjab, Bihar and Gujarat accounted for more than 80 per cent share in total production.
